    Why Property Management is Essential in Pretoria

    Let's get real – managing a property isn't just about collecting rent. Effective property management in Pretoria involves a whole range of tasks, each critical to the success of your investment. Think of it as running a mini-business; you need to handle marketing, tenant screening, maintenance, legal compliance, and financial reporting, among other things. For those of you juggling full-time jobs or managing multiple properties, this can quickly become overwhelming. A good property manager steps in to handle these responsibilities, ensuring your property is well-maintained, your tenants are happy, and your investment is protected.

    First off, consider the time savings. How much is your time worth? Managing a property can eat up hours each week – dealing with tenant inquiries, coordinating repairs, and handling emergencies. A property manager takes these tasks off your plate, freeing you up to focus on other priorities. Next, think about tenant quality. A property manager has the tools and experience to thoroughly screen potential tenants, reducing the risk of late payments, property damage, or legal issues. They know what to look for in a tenant application and how to conduct background checks effectively. Maintaining your property is also super important. Regular maintenance is crucial for preserving the value of your investment. Property managers can arrange for routine inspections, handle repairs promptly, and ensure your property remains in top condition. This not only keeps tenants happy but also prevents costly problems down the road. Then there's the legal stuff. Landlord-tenant laws can be complex, and non-compliance can lead to legal headaches and financial penalties. Property managers are well-versed in these laws and can ensure you're always on the right side of the law. Finally, let's not forget about financial management. A property manager can handle rent collection, pay bills, and provide detailed financial reports, giving you a clear picture of your property's performance. This transparency is essential for making informed decisions about your investment.

    Key Qualities to Look for in a Pretoria Property Manager

    Okay, so you're sold on the idea of hiring a property manager. Great! But how do you choose the right one? Finding the best property management in Pretoria requires careful consideration. Not all property managers are created equal, and it's essential to find someone who aligns with your goals and values. Here are some key qualities to look for:

    Firstly, you need experience and local knowledge. Look for a property manager with a proven track record in the Pretoria area. They should have a deep understanding of the local market, including rental rates, tenant demographics, and neighborhood trends. They should also be familiar with local regulations and compliance requirements. Next, communication skills are vital. A good property manager should be responsive, proactive, and transparent in their communication. They should keep you informed about important issues, provide regular updates on your property's performance, and be readily available to answer your questions. Also, check out their tenant management skills. Effective tenant management is crucial for maintaining a positive landlord-tenant relationship. The property manager should be skilled at screening tenants, handling complaints, enforcing lease terms, and resolving disputes. They should also have a system in place for dealing with evictions if necessary. You definitely want to consider their maintenance and repair management. The property manager should have a network of reliable contractors and be able to handle maintenance and repair requests promptly and efficiently. They should also be able to negotiate fair prices and ensure the quality of work. Of course, financial management is key. The property manager should have strong financial management skills and be able to handle rent collection, bill payments, and financial reporting accurately and transparently. They should also provide you with regular financial statements and be able to answer any questions you have about your property's finances. And last but not least, licensing and insurance are non-negotiable. Make sure the property manager is properly licensed and insured to operate in Pretoria. This protects you from liability in case of accidents, injuries, or other unforeseen events.

    How to Find Top Property Management in Pretoria

    Alright, you know what to look for in property management in Pretoria, but how do you actually find these gems? Don't worry; I've got you covered. Here are some tried-and-true methods for finding the best property manager for your needs:

    First off, ask for referrals. Start by asking friends, family, and other property owners in Pretoria for referrals. Personal recommendations can be incredibly valuable, as they come from people you trust. Ask them about their experiences with different property managers and what they liked or disliked. Another great way is to search online. Use search engines like Google to find property management companies in Pretoria. Look for companies with positive reviews and high ratings. Check out their websites and social media profiles to get a sense of their services and expertise. Online directories are your friend. Websites like Property24 and Private Property often have directories of property managers in Pretoria. These directories allow you to filter your search based on location, services offered, and other criteria. Remember to attend industry events. Keep an eye out for real estate conferences, property investment seminars, and other industry events in Pretoria. These events provide an opportunity to meet property managers in person, learn about their services, and network with other property owners. Plus, it's always good to stay informed of latest trends to see if the manager is really on top of things. When you've got a few candidates, conduct interviews. Once you've identified a few potential property managers, schedule interviews with them. Prepare a list of questions to ask about their experience, services, fees, and approach to property management. This is your chance to get to know them better and see if they're a good fit for your needs. And finally, check references. Before making a final decision, ask the property manager for references from current or past clients. Contact these references and ask about their experiences with the property manager. This can provide valuable insights into the property manager's performance and reliability.

    Common Mistakes to Avoid When Hiring a Property Manager

    Listen up, folks! Hiring a property manager is a big decision, and it's easy to make mistakes along the way. But don't stress! I'm here to help you avoid common pitfalls and ensure you choose the best property manager for your Pretoria property. Knowing what mistakes to avoid can save you time, money, and a whole lot of frustration.

    First up, not doing your research. One of the biggest mistakes is not doing enough research before hiring a property manager. Don't just go with the first company you find. Take the time to thoroughly investigate different property managers, compare their services and fees, and check their references. Another classic one is ignoring red flags. Pay attention to any red flags that come up during your research or interviews. This could include negative reviews, a lack of transparency, or a reluctance to provide references. Trust your gut and don't ignore warning signs. Make sure you failing to read the contract carefully. Always read the property management contract carefully before signing it. Make sure you understand all the terms and conditions, including the fees, services, and termination clauses. Don't be afraid to ask questions or negotiate terms that you're not comfortable with. Similarly, neglecting to discuss expectations is a bad idea. Have a clear discussion with the property manager about your expectations for their services. This includes things like communication frequency, maintenance standards, and tenant screening criteria. Make sure you're both on the same page and have a shared understanding of your goals. Also, not checking their licensing and insurance is a huge no-no. Always verify that the property manager is properly licensed and insured to operate in Pretoria. This protects you from liability in case of accidents, injuries, or other unforeseen events. And finally, failing to stay involved in the process is risky. Even after you've hired a property manager, it's important to stay involved in the process. Regularly check in with the property manager, review financial reports, and inspect your property periodically. This helps you stay informed and ensure your property is being managed effectively.
